Thank you for being here The purpose of Document Control is to ensure that documentation is trusted by its users and that it contains up-to-date, reliable, checked and formally approved information. Document Control also creates auditable records of the activity surrounding the production, the exchange and the modification of documentation. So, what is Document Control? Its a document management profession whose purpose is to enforce controlled processes and practices for the creation, review, modification, issuance, distribution and accessibility of docu

How to start a document control system Step 1: Identify documents and workflows. Step 2: Establish ownership and quality standards. Step 3: Name and classify documents. Step 4: Create revision protocols. Step 5: Manage security and access. Step 6: Classify and archive documents to ensure version control.
Simply put, a controlled document is a document that is subject to certain controls to ensure its accuracy and completeness. In order to be considered a controlled document, it must meet certain criteria, such as being approved by a designated authority and having a defined review and update schedule.
Examples of controlled documentation are company policies, work procedures, manuals or production documentation.
A document control system is a technology used to track, manage, and store digital documents as well as scanned copies of paper documents. The goal is simple: to improve access to important documents.
A document control system is a formal set of tools and processes that ensure vital documents in a company are created, approved, distributed, and archived systematically throughout their lifecycle. Document control systems bring order to complex operations.
Document control can be defined as a series of practices that ensure that documents are created, reviewed, distributed, and disposed of in an organized and verifiable manner. You might also use the term document management.
